3 © 2012 Autodesk Class Summary  This class will move you beyond the basics of the project execution plan and will examine collaboration practices that can help you better meet the expectations of improved coordination. The coordination tools that are available in Autodesk Revit software enable you to extend your established processes, and this class will provide the know-how to streamline the use of new techniques to augment your workflows. Successful coordination in Revit begins with the coordinate system, and we will cover project and shared coordinate setup along with coordinate alignment techniques. We will demonstrate several round-trip model exchanges to illustrate the best modeling techniques to ensure effective use of the Copy/Monitor and Coordination Review tools. We will also present additional view setup approaches using custom parameters to show you how to supplement the Coordination Review report. This class is a culmination of refining workflows over 6 years of collaboration with clients in Revit.

23 © 2012 Autodesk “STOP COLLABORATE AND LISTEN”  The Coordinate System is Key to Understand  Is the Architect Utilizing Project Internal or Shared Coordinates?

24 © 2012 Autodesk “STOP COLLABORATE AND LISTEN”  Copy / Monitor  It is not Bi-Directional  Maps Elements via Element ID’s  Do Not Delete & Redraw Copy/Monitored Elements  Have a Copy Monitor Plan and Stick to It

25 © 2012 Autodesk “STOP COLLABORATE AND LISTEN”  View Filters can Help Supplement Coordination Review  Establish a Plan on How to Control Link Visibility  Define the Elements to be Shown Thru Link  Communicate at which Phase Certain Elements Will Show Thru Link Accurately.

26 © 2012 Autodesk “STOP COLLABORATE AND LISTEN”  Model to How it Will Be Constructed  Consider Your Constraints on Interior Wall Partitions  Avoid Creating Openings with the Edit Wall Profile

27 © 2012 Autodesk “STOP COLLABORATE AND LISTEN”  Resolve Issues in Coordination Review After Each Model Exchange  Resolve Each Issue One Rule at a Time

28 © 2012 Autodesk “STOP COLLABORATE AND LISTEN”  Utilize the Project Relocate Tool when Necessary  Understand the Clipped vs. Unclipped Model State
